With a Sony stabilized lens is attached to a Sony body with IBIS, does turning OFF image stabilization on EITHER also turns OFF image stabilization on the other?
Is from the a6500 online help.
- When you set [SteadyShot] to [On]/[Off], the SteadyShot settings of the camera and lens switch at the same time.
- If a lens equipped with a SteadyShot switch is attached, the settings can only be changed using that switch on the lens. You cannot switch the settings using the camera.
